HealthPandemonium In Plateau, Mortuary As A Dead Man Grabbed His Brother's Hand by koolsnoop2(op): 7:50am On May 02, 2017
There was pandemonium, yesterday, in Plateau Specialist Hospital, Jos, mortuary when a dead man, Choji Zeng, who was being dressed up for burial by his younger brother, Mr. Gyang Zeng, grabbed the brother’s hand.
Family members, who had participated in the washing of the corpse, ran out in panic when they saw the dead Choji holding tight to Gyang’s hand.
The confusion attracted mortuary attendants, who came in and separated the brothers, who had lived together at Ungwan Juma’a Abattoir in Jos metropolis until Choji, 35, died after a brief illness.
Gyang, who confirmed the unusual incident, said after bathing his brother, he was dressing him with white cloth, when the corpse grabbed his hands. He said it was a mortuary attendant that forced the dead hands off him.
Relations and neighbours, who witnessed the incident, also confirmed it.
Gyang revealed that when the deceased held his hands, he asked him: “Choji, why did you hold my hand, you want me to join you or what?”
One of the mortuary attendants said that it was not the first time such a thing will happen in the mortuary.
Mr. Benjamin Oche, a neighbour of the two brothers, who also witnessed the incident, said before Choji died, both brothers had a misunderstanding over the land they inherited from their parents.
However, no foul play was being suspected in Choji’s death.

Jobs/VacanciesRe: How To Get Your Dream Job by koolsnoop2(m): 10:59am On Apr 12, 2017
The next logical step after schooling (or NYSC for Nigerian graduates) is to get a job. This is usually not the case for most job-seekers. Many of them have to wait from between one to ten years before landing a "good" job.

Personally for me I don't believe there are no jobs. The challenge most time is how to get the available jobs. The truth is that people get new jobs every day. People are promoted every day and the posts they leave behind are still vacant. Businesses are being registered on a daily basis (na spirits dem employ?).

After establishing the fact that there are jobs, the next thing is to have a plan and a definite strategy. You must understand that the conventional way of getting a job will not work for everybody. Your chances in the conventional ways are limited because of the population of people looking for the same thing you're looking for. Some even have better qualifications than you. That's why you need to strategize!

How to plan and strategize

The economy is divided into sectors/industries, these industries are sub-divided into firms. What you studied might not be found in every firm (unlike accounting or IT). So you have to identify the firms that need your skills. Get the details of these firms, their names, location, what they do etc. This information will guide your approach. Prepare a good CV and cover letter. Don't wait for them to ask you for your CV. Don't send soft copy only. These companies receive thousands of CV online daily. Go to the company physically.

Don't just give your CV and Covet Letter to the gatemen/security, not the receptionist not even the HR (in some cases). Try and get it to a top management staff, or a P.A to the MD. You can get to meet a top person who works there on LinkedIn.

The idea is to get their attention at all cost. This will land you an invite. The other process of test, series of interviews, etc, you'll also need to be well prepared.

I challenge you today, go and make a difference. Get that dream job. Don't reduce your expectations.
